So it's actually the wooden toy set that we used to play with when we're kids
I'm not sure if u guys did remember about this
But I did played this wooden brick with my siblings and cousin during childhood






Basically the players would consist of probably 5 person and we need to put 3 cuboid on the floor vertically and put some more on top of it horizontally and make the same arrangement for about 10 rows altogether * depends on how much wooden cuboid u have*
So the game start!

First person needs to pull out one of the cuboid very carefully so that the wooden building block does not collapse
Then the second player will take turn to pull another one

Let's say a player ruin the building block, he/she will immediately kicked out off the game ๐Ÿ˜†
The remaining players will build again the balance of the cuboid and the game keep repeating until there is only 1 player left with clean record and he/she will consider the winner
The final moment of the game is the most intense part

Usually, the survivors will start to make it harder for their opponents by erasing the bottom part of the wooden building so it will reduce the stability of ground surface of the whole structure ๐Ÿคฃ
This got me nervous every freaking time
And by pulling just one cuboid either from top, from the side or bottom, could demolish the entire wooden blocks and the game ends ~

At this very moment, we then realized, every state of emotion, there must be something that triggers it to happen

and guess what..it's actually just the tiny little  thing that make us cry and break down and

the fact that, that tiny little thing didn't come alone to break us

Is it normal for a 20's something years old girl  crying over her spilled drink on the floor when she just about to leave

She aren't supposed to get irritated easily  just because of her shirt stuck at the doorknob in the morning

It's illogical if she cried just because her husband get her kueyteow tomyam instead of bihun tomyam she been craving for

Or when she gives up of preparing dinner altogether due to the glass jar lid that is too tight to open

It's irrational to see these scenario but it's actually exist around us

Have u watch a kdrama scene when a pregnant wife cry out loud just because she can't tie up her shoelace?
If I'm not mistaken that scene is from "Hometown Cha3" TV drama
The lady can't bend down to the ground due to her preggy belly
But why did she cried a river, cursing "stupid shoelace" and yelling his husband?
It just the shoelace ๐Ÿ˜…
I mean, do she really need to act dramatically because of the shoelace?
It's normal for a kid to react that way but she obviously a grownup fine woman

Well actually, the real reason of that tears is because she's too tired and exhausted
She fedup over her ignorance, unhelpful husband who take lightly of her pregnancy journey needs all these months pregnant phase
The innocent shoelace is consider her last reserved card

So let's say u see people crying over a petty issue, and thought they are being immature,
kindly..think again
Cuz u probably wrong

It's actually a set of feelings that bottling up within us

The tears is just very close underneath the surface, resting, waiting to be released out.

Just like the unstable building block that we build
It just takes a wooden cuboid to destroy all within a second ,
then..puffff!
All shattered into pieces

It does not destroyed because of that tiny cuboid that the player pull out
But indeed it destroyed because of unstable and the burden that the building carry on its back all this while

Just like us
The heaviness, the unsettle feelings, the fatigue,
the patience put into,  the hurdles
Everything is mounting onto us
That's why we can easily broken into pieces due to mere little things that we reserved for the last ⚘
